GSStyle class

Constructors

GSStyle.new({double? borderWidth, Color? borderColor, double? borderRadius, EdgeInsetsGeometry? padding, double? opacity, Color? color, Color? bg, Color? borderBottomColor, double? height, EdgeInsetsGeometry? margin, GSPlacement? placement, double? width, double? gap, double? outlineWidth, GSOutlineStyle? outlineStyle, GSFlexDirections? flexDirection, double? borderBottomWidth, double? borderLeftWidth, TextStyle? textStyle, GSStyle? checked, GSStyle? onHover, GSStyle? onFocus, GSStyle? onActive, GSStyle? onDisabled, GSStyle? input, GSStyle? icon, GSStyle? dark, GSStyle? xs, GSStyle? sm, GSStyle? md, GSStyle? lg, GSStyle? onInvalid, GSStyle? web, GSStyle? ios, GSStyle? android, GSAlignments? alignItems, GSAlignments? justifyContent, AlignmentGeometry? alignment, double? maxWidth, GSStyle? badge, GSTextTransform? textTransform, Color? trackColorTrue, Color? trackColorFalse, Color? thumbColor, Color? activeThumbColor, Color? iosBackgroundColor, double? scale, Color? outlineColor, GSCursors? cursors, GSSizes? iconSize, double? bottom, double? left, double? right, double? top, bool? isVisible, Axis? direction, double indent = 0, double endIndent = 0, Color? iconColor, GSStyle? item, Color? shadowColor, double? shadowRadius, double? shadowOpacity, double? elevation, ShadowOffset? shadowOffset, TextAlign? textAlign})

Properties

activeThumbColor Color?
getter/setter pair
alignItems GSAlignments?
getter/setter pair
alignment AlignmentGeometry?
getter/setter pair
android GSStyle?
getter/setter pairinherited
badge GSStyle?
getter/setter pair
bg Color?
getter/setter pair
borderBottomColor Color?
getter/setter pair
borderBottomWidth double?
getter/setter pair
borderColor Color?
getter/setter pair
borderLeftWidth double?
getter/setter pair
borderRadius double?
getter/setter pair
borderWidth double?
getter/setter pair
bottom double?
getter/setter pair
checked GSStyle?
getter/setter pair
color Color?
getter/setter pair
contextStyles LinkedHashMap<String, GSStyle?>
no setterinherited
cursors GSCursors?
getter/setter pair
dark GSStyle?
getter/setter pairinherited
direction Axis?
getter/setter pair
elevation double?
getter/setter pair
endIndent double
getter/setter pair
flexDirection GSFlexDirections?
getter/setter pair
gap double?
getter/setter pair
hashCode int
The hash code for this object.
no setterinherited
height double?
getter/setter pair
icon GSStyle?
getter/setter pairinherited
iconColor Color?
getter/setter pair
iconSize GSSizes?
getter/setter pair
indent double
getter/setter pair
input GSStyle?
getter/setter pairinherited
ios GSStyle?
getter/setter pairinherited
iosBackgroundColor Color?
getter/setter pair
isVisible bool?
getter/setter pair
item GSStyle?
getter/setter pair
justifyContent GSAlignments?
getter/setter pair
left double?
getter/setter pair
lg GSStyle?
getter/setter pairinherited
margin EdgeInsetsGeometry?
getter/setter pair
maxWidth double?
getter/setter pair
md GSStyle?
getter/setter pairinherited
onActive GSStyle?
getter/setter pairinherited
onDisabled GSStyle?
getter/setter pairinherited
onFocus GSStyle?
getter/setter pairinherited
onHover GSStyle?
getter/setter pairinherited
onInvalid GSStyle?
getter/setter pairinherited
opacity double?
getter/setter pair
outlineColor Color?
getter/setter pair
outlineStyle GSOutlineStyle?
getter/setter pair
outlineWidth double?
getter/setter pair
padding EdgeInsetsGeometry?
getter/setter pair
placement GSPlacement?
getter/setter pair
getter/setter pair
runtimeType Type
A representation of the runtime type of the object.
no setterinherited
scale double?
getter/setter pair
shadowColor Color?
getter/setter pair
shadowOffset ShadowOffset?
getter/setter pair
shadowOpacity double?
getter/setter pair
shadowRadius double?
getter/setter pair
sm GSStyle?
getter/setter pairinherited
textAlign TextAlign?
getter/setter pair
textStyle TextStyle?
getter/setter pair
textTransform GSTextTransform?
getter/setter pair
thumbColor Color?
getter/setter pair
top double?
getter/setter pair
trackColorFalse Color?
getter/setter pair
trackColorTrue Color?
getter/setter pair
web GSStyle?
getter/setter pairinherited
width double?
getter/setter pair
xs GSStyle?
getter/setter pairinherited
xxl GSStyle?
getter/setter pairinherited

Methods

copy() GSStyle
merge(GSStyle? overrideStyle, {List<String> descendantStyleKeys = const []}) GSStyle
noSuchMethod(Invocation invocation) → dynamic
Invoked when a nonexistent method or property is accessed.
inherited
toString() String
A string representation of this object.
inherited

Operators

operator ==(Object other) bool
The equality operator.
inherited

Static Methods

fromGSConfigStyle(GSConfigStyle styler, BuildContext context) GSStyle